That's not correct, it's explicitly covered back during the academy flashback chapters where they make simple synthetic dungeons and then Farlyn takes Marcille out to see a natural dungeon during that first real bonding moment. Dungeons seem to be a natural feature of that world, though natural ones are fairly simple and face limitations on natural magic and ecosystem mechanics. They can also be created artificially, inspired by the natural ones, with all the normal ones people try also being limited by magic input.

The Ancients likely took that existing concept and found it usefully adaptable to turn into vastly more complex self-healing/propagating labyrinth prisons for their hypermagic gates to make sure demons wouldn't escape. Synthetic containment dungeons are vastly more complex, and react with hostility to desire, perhaps part of a programmed into auto defense system due to their true purpose. Creatures without desires aren't a threat to containment.

Probably part of the problem for the Ancients is that they directly wanted to make use of hyper magic to power actual projects, be it for peace or for the super war that kicked off later. So they were never able/willing to make a stable system. Thistle managed to game things because he wanted to create a cutoff forever world without any outside interaction, and figured out how to split the demon up and prevent/limit its feeding on him. With access to no one else it was stuck.
